About ABS & Traction Control
A warning light or a system that quit working points to an ABS or traction control fault, the safety net that keeps your tires from locking or spinning.
- Wheel Speed Sensors: A dirty or failed wheel speed sensor is the most common ABS fault, tripping the light and disabling the system.
- Modules & Pumps: The ABS module and pump apply the system, and a failure here needs a replacement to restore function.
- Tone Rings: A damaged tone ring gives the sensor a bad signal, so inspect it when chasing an intermittent ABS light.
